Job Description:
Overview The CMA/RMA Coordinator coordinates the Medical
Assistant (MA) and Certified Medical Assistant (CMA) activity for
assigned clinical departments under the direction of the Nursing
Supervisor. Collaborates with Nursing Supervisor to ensure
appropriate staffing levels are maintained and department workflows
are effective and efficient. Oversees all POC competencies for
departments, involved in training and onboarding of new CMA's,
assists with annual CMA competencies, provides patient care,
assists with in-basket work. Qualifications Certifications: Basic

Responsibilities Performs essential job functions of CMA's POC
Coordination: competencies, audits, maintenance of POC regulatory
requirements, POC/Safety Fair Completes performance appraisals and
HSL conversations with direct reports in conjunction with the RN
Supervisor Collaborates with RN Supervisor for all disciplinary and
formal coaching of direct reports Coordinates CMA schedules;
approve time off requests; general timekeeping Involved in DNV
preparedness Onboarding and training of new CMA's under the
direction of the RN Supervisor Works with RN Supervisor to ensure
VFC requirements are maintained Orders department supplies and
ensures par levels are maintained Coordination of monthly staff
meetings with insight from the RN Supervisor Maintains departmental
logs and audits Perform other duties as assigned. 50% clinical
assignment on floor & 50% admin time Administration of
immunizations, PPD testing, nebulizer treatments, oral medication
administration to patients age 18-150 Obtain VS on patients age
18-150 to include weight, height, blood pressure, pulse, pulse ox
Complete medication reconciliation of al medications in office to
include over the counter medications Perform pre-visit telephone
calls complete medication reconciliation allergy/history
verification Assist with patient forms 50% of time spent working
with an assigned provider, maintain the provider's Team Based Care
binder 50% of time spent on administrative funictions: staff
scheudling, day to day department flow, staff discipline w/ nursing
supervisor, staff evaluations with nursing supervisor, patient
concerns related to staff/service recovery, department auditing
